About Shin Splints
The Anatomy of the Shin
Your shins are comprised of:
- The tibia or front bone of the lower leg, which is one of the two bones in the shin. It extends from the knee to the ankle and is charged with bearing a large part of the body’s weight during activities.
- The proximal end which connects the femur to the knee and enables bending and extension of the leg
- The distal end, which forms the medial malleolus, which is the bony part on the inside of your ankle and forms the ankle joint
- The interosseous membrane, a robust, fibrous sheet of connective tissue that joins the two bones in the shin, which helps maintain balance and stabilizes the lower leg
- Multiple muscles in the leg, like the anterior tibialis, posterior tibialis, and soleus, which attach to the tibia via tendons, and are responsible for various movements of the foot and ankle, including dorsiflexion (toes moving toward your shin), plantarflexion (toes moving away from your shin), and inversion.
- Arteries which carry blood and nutrients to the area
- Nerves that carry messages and instructions between your shin and your brain
- Ligaments which connect the tibia with neighboring bones and joints, provide stability, and limit excessive movement
The shin is responsible for:
- Supporting the weight of your body as you stand and move around
- Providing stability as you stand and walk
- Connecting the knee to the ankle
- Linking various muscles, tendons, and ligaments
- Protecting arteries, veins, and nerves
What Are Shin Splints?
Shin splints, also known as Medial Tibial Stress Syndrome, refer to the pain in the front part of your shin arising from inflammation in muscles, tendons, and the bone tissue itself. Shin splints usually present as pain down the forefront or inner edge of the shinbone, and the pain might be sharp or dull.
Common shin splint symptoms include:
- Pain
- Tenderness
- Mild swelling
- Pain during activity
- Discomfort at rest in more severe cases
What Causes Shin Splints?
Our shins face considerable stresses, both during our day-to-day lives and when we put our bodies under more strain. When that stress is more than our bodies can safely handle and causes the pain called shin splints, it’s typically due to:
Overexertion and Strain
Every step, jump, or stride exerts demands on the shin. Just like any section of the body, the shin can be overworked. When subjected to more stress than it can handle, or when not given enough time to recover, your body tells you so by sending pain signals to your brain. This overuse can lead to:
- Micro-tears in the muscle fibers
- Inflammation of the tendons
- Stress responses in the bone
Exercise Mistakes and Shoes
Two significant culprits responsible for overworking the shins are:
- Incorrect Workout Methods — Suddenly boosting the strength, frequency, or duration of exercises instead of increasing intensity gradually can be a recipe for shin splints.
- Unsuitable Shoes — Shoes that don’t provide adequate support or have tattered soles can contribute to shin splints. They can force the foot and leg to adjust in abnormal ways, placing extra stress on the shin.
Biomechanical Irregularities
Genetic differences or anomalies in foot arches, gait, or posture can lead to poor biomechanics, such as:
- Low arches or overpronation (when the foot rolls inward more than it should)
- High arches which may not absorb shock well
- Unevenness in muscle strength or flexibility in the lower body
External Factors
Elements related to how you exercise can be in effect, such as:
- Working out on irregular terrain or slopes
- Constant uphill or downhill running lacking variation
- Not allowing adequate recovery time between strenuous workouts
Past Injuries
A history of shin splints can increase the probability of future occurrences, as the tissues might not have fully healed or may be more prone to injury.
Shin splints are common athletic injuries and commonly occur with beginner runners.

Conservative Shin Shin Treatment in Moselle, MO
As shin splints are frequent and can often vanish on their own, most shin splint treatment plans in Moselle, MO commence conservatively:
Using the R.I.C.E. Approach
The R.I.C.E. method is the initial line of treatment for many injuries. It stands for Rest, Ice, Compression, Elevation:
- Rest
- Allow the swollen tissues to heal by stepping back from intense activities
- Think about shifting to gentler exercises like swimming or cycling for the time being
- Ice
- Use cold packs to the sore area for 15-20 minutes per session, multiple times a day
- Make sure to use a cloth or towel between the ice and skin to avoid frostbite
- Compression
- Wearing an ACE bandage can aid in minimizing swelling
- Be certain it’s firm but not too tight to restrict blood flow
- Elevation
- Prop up the sore leg on cushions when relaxing
- Raising the leg above heart level can help decrease swelling and encourage faster healing
Pain Relief Measures
Common pain relief measures include:
- Over-the-Counter (OTC) Medications —
- Nonsteroidal anti-inflammatory drugs like ibuprofen can assist reduce pain and inflammation.
- Always follow dosage recommendations and talk to a healthcare provider if in doubt.
- Stretching Exercises — Soft calf and shin stretches can relieve tension in the muscles surrounding the shinbone.
- Calf Stretch — Stand facing a wall with hands pushed against it. Step one foot back, keeping it stays flat on the ground, and bend the front knee. Keep for 20-30 seconds and alternate sides.
- Shin Stretch — While sitting, extend one leg out. Point and flex the foot, experiencing a stretch across the front of the shin. Hold for 20-30 seconds and switch sides.

Physical Therapy Exercises and Techniques for Shin Splint Treatment
Physical therapy treatment plans for the majority of injuries is focused on recovering and cultivating strength and range of motion, limiting pain, and injury prevention. With shin splint treatment, Moselle, MO physical therapists can help you with:
- Strength Training —
- Toe Raises — While seated with feet flat on the ground, elevate the toes while making sure heels are anchored. This builds the anterior tibialis, the muscle on the front of the shin.
- Calf Raises — While standing on a flat surface, lift onto the balls of the feet, then gradually lower. This builds the calf muscles, offering better support to the shin.
- Flexibility Exercises —
- Foam Rolling — Using a foam roller on the calf and anterior tibialis can assist reduce tightness.
- Dynamic Stretches — Leg swings or ankle circles can enhance flexibility and range of motion.
- Balance and Proprioception Training —
- Single Leg Stands — Standing on one leg assists improve balance and builds stabilizing muscles.
- Wobble Board Exercises — Employing a wobble board or balance pad can push and enhance proprioceptive abilities, diminishing the risk of recurrent injuries.
Physical therapy offers a comprehensive approach, centering not merely on immediate relief but also on extended prevention by addressing biomechanical inefficiencies and muscle imbalances.
Shin Splint Treatments like Ultrasound and Electric Stimulation
If shin splints continue or if they’re especially severe, physical therapists may use certain modalities to help in the healing process. These techniques can optimize recovery and guarantee a return to activities with minimal discomfort.
- Ultrasound Therapy —
- Deep Tissue Stimulation — Uses sound waves to promote activity in deep tissues, encouraging healing and minimizing inflammation.
- Increased Blood Flow — The gentle heat created by ultrasound boosts blood flow to the injured area, speeding up the healing process.
- Electric Stimulation (E-Stim) —
- Pain Relief — E-Stim employs electrical currents to block pain signals sent to the brain, providing immediate relief.
- Muscle Activation — By stimulating muscle contraction, E-Stim can stop muscle atrophy owing to inactivity from pain.
- Improved Healing — The electrical currents can enhance blood circulation, fostering faster tissue repair.

Shin Splint Prevention and Training Tips
Having an active lifestyle while lessening the risk of shin splints requires a blend of awareness, preparation, and consistency. Incorporating particular strategies and practices can drastically reduce the chances of experiencing this annoying condition, ensuring your fitness journey remains uninterrupted and enjoyable.
Proper Footwear and Orthotics
Choosing Appropriate Footwear
- Activity-specific — Choose shoes specially designed for your primary activity, guaranteeing they offer the needed support and cushioning.
- Comfortable Fit — A snug fit without being too tight, and adequate cushioning, can make a vast of difference.
- Timely Replacement — Footwear loses structural integrity with time. Often replacing athletic shoes can prevent unnecessary strain on the shins.
Orthotics and Inserts
- Prescribed Solutions — For those with unique foot structures or gait abnormalities, personalized orthotics can provide customized support, alleviating stress on the shin.
- Over-the-counter Options — Pre-made inserts can offer added cushioning or arch support, boosting the protective qualities of your shoes.
Gradual Training Increases and Incorporating Rest Days
Progressive Training
- Ease Into It — Especially if you’re new to an activity, start with mild intensities and durations, gradually ramping up as your body adjusts.
- The 10% Rule — As a principle, avoid boosting the volume or intensity of your training by over 10% per week to ward off overuse.
Importance of Rest and Recovery
- Planned Rest — Integrate rest days or easier activity periods into your training routine, permitting muscles and connective tissues to recover.
- Listen to Your Body — Master to recognize signs of overwhelming fatigue or strain. If something seems off, it might be time to ease back or take an additional rest day.
Flexibility and Strength as a Foundation
- Consistent Stretching — Integrate stretching routines aiming at the calves, shins, and surrounding muscles. This not only prevents shin splints but also improves overall leg function.
- Dynamic Warm-ups — Before exerting yourself physically, dynamic stretches like leg swings or ankle circles can prepare the body and lessen injury risks.
